jameshuntz:
Not a new hunter to Idaho but this will be my first time with Unit 39. Looking for peoples thoughts on this unit. I know its busy, i know theres a lot of animals. I will be solo hunting deep and steep so im not worried about other people so much. Migration hunt depending on when in october i go? ideally would go last week of Oct. Appreciate any input.

skills:
I'm not sure if there is deep or steep enough to get away from hunters there.  Expect company no matter where you go there.  Lots of game though.   I'm not sure how long that will last, but there is a crazy amount of wildlife there for the pressure it gets.

Taco280AI:
Very crowded, gets worse every year. Used to be I could hike back four miles and hardly see anyone. Now there's a dozen people back four miles with me. Get away from roads, get away from trails. If you see a big, steep, nasty looking mountain you don't want to climb, that's a good place to start. There is lots of game, just lots of people too. Go where they don't want to and you'll see the game.
